(ART 465) Advanced Sculpture

An advanced sculpture studio course exploring various methods and techniques of modeling in wax and mold-making. Slides of the work will be integrated into senior portfolios. Fee required.

Credit Hours 3.0 Lecture
Prerequisite ART 365
Offered Winter

Course Learning Outcomes

  1. Approach mastery of your chosen area of emphasis.
  2. Become fluent in using the elements of design as a visual language to express yourself as an artist.
  3. Refine your ability to conceptualize and visualize objects in three dimensions.  
  4. Define your voice and identity as an artist. Know where you and your work fit into the broader art scene. 
  5. Articulate where the kind of work you are interested in doing fits into the ark of art history. 
  6. Continue to research what other artists are doing in your chosen field of expression.
